There are few papers for nonuniform in-plane motions of wings, practical applications of which may concern lead-lag motion of helicopter blades and motions of horizontal stabilizer in T-ail flutter. This paper presents a practical application for the basic formulation, which was developed by the present authors in reference 1. An airfoil having an arbitrary camber line is assumed to fly in a sinusoidally pulsating steam, which is inviscid and incompressible. Explicit formulae of lift distribution, lift and pitching moment are presented. The fact pointed out by ISAACS, the quasi-steady theory leads to a significant error, is confirmed in a more general way.
